init project

This commit is contained in:
Jasder
2020-03-09 00:40:16 +08:00
commit 2937b2a94d
6549 changed files with 7215173 additions and 0 deletions

View File

@@ -0,0 +1,14 @@
require 'rails_helper'
RSpec.describe "courses/edit", type: :view do
before(:each) do
@course = assign(:course, Course.create!())
end
it "renders the edit course form" do
render
assert_select "form[action=?][method=?]", course_path(@course), "post" do
end
end
end

View File

@@ -0,0 +1,14 @@
require 'rails_helper'
RSpec.describe "courses/index", type: :view do
before(:each) do
assign(:courses, [
Course.create!(),
Course.create!()
])
end
it "renders a list of courses" do
render
end
end

View File

@@ -0,0 +1,14 @@
require 'rails_helper'
RSpec.describe "courses/new", type: :view do
before(:each) do
assign(:course, Course.new())
end
it "renders new course form" do
render
assert_select "form[action=?][method=?]", courses_path, "post" do
end
end
end

View File

@@ -0,0 +1,11 @@
require 'rails_helper'
RSpec.describe "courses/show", type: :view do
before(:each) do
@course = assign(:course, Course.create!())
end
it "renders attributes in <p>" do
render
end
end

View File

@@ -0,0 +1,21 @@
require 'rails_helper'
RSpec.describe "edu_settings/edit", type: :view do
before(:each) do
@edu_setting = assign(:edu_setting, EduSetting.create!(
:name => "MyString",
:value => "MyString"
))
end
it "renders the edit edu_setting form" do
render
assert_select "form[action=?][method=?]", edu_setting_path(@edu_setting), "post" do
assert_select "input[name=?]", "edu_setting[name]"
assert_select "input[name=?]", "edu_setting[value]"
end
end
end

View File

@@ -0,0 +1,22 @@
require 'rails_helper'
RSpec.describe "edu_settings/index", type: :view do
before(:each) do
assign(:edu_settings, [
EduSetting.create!(
:name => "Name",
:value => "Value"
),
EduSetting.create!(
:name => "Name",
:value => "Value"
)
])
end
it "renders a list of edu_settings" do
render
assert_select "tr>td", :text => "Name".to_s, :count => 2
assert_select "tr>td", :text => "Value".to_s, :count => 2
end
end

View File

@@ -0,0 +1,21 @@
require 'rails_helper'
RSpec.describe "edu_settings/new", type: :view do
before(:each) do
assign(:edu_setting, EduSetting.new(
:name => "MyString",
:value => "MyString"
))
end
it "renders new edu_setting form" do
render
assert_select "form[action=?][method=?]", edu_settings_path, "post" do
assert_select "input[name=?]", "edu_setting[name]"
assert_select "input[name=?]", "edu_setting[value]"
end
end
end

View File

@@ -0,0 +1,16 @@
require 'rails_helper'
RSpec.describe "edu_settings/show", type: :view do
before(:each) do
@edu_setting = assign(:edu_setting, EduSetting.create!(
:name => "Name",
:value => "Value"
))
end
it "renders attributes in <p>" do
render
expect(rendered).to match(/Name/)
expect(rendered).to match(/Value/)
end
end

View File

@@ -0,0 +1,5 @@
require 'rails_helper'
RSpec.describe "home/index.html.erb", type: :view do
pending "add some examples to (or delete) #{__FILE__}"
end

View File

@@ -0,0 +1,14 @@
require 'rails_helper'
RSpec.describe "memos/edit", type: :view do
before(:each) do
@memo = assign(:memo, Memo.create!())
end
it "renders the edit memo form" do
render
assert_select "form[action=?][method=?]", memo_path(@memo), "post" do
end
end
end

View File

@@ -0,0 +1,14 @@
require 'rails_helper'
RSpec.describe "memos/index", type: :view do
before(:each) do
assign(:memos, [
Memo.create!(),
Memo.create!()
])
end
it "renders a list of memos" do
render
end
end

View File

@@ -0,0 +1,14 @@
require 'rails_helper'
RSpec.describe "memos/new", type: :view do
before(:each) do
assign(:memo, Memo.new())
end
it "renders new memo form" do
render
assert_select "form[action=?][method=?]", memos_path, "post" do
end
end
end

View File

@@ -0,0 +1,11 @@
require 'rails_helper'
RSpec.describe "memos/show", type: :view do
before(:each) do
@memo = assign(:memo, Memo.create!())
end
it "renders attributes in <p>" do
render
end
end